Lysimachia terrestris (Earth Loosestrife) is a species of perennial herb in the family Primulaceae. They have a self-supporting growth form. They are native to Saint-Pierre Et Miquelon, The Contiguous United States, Eastern North America, North America, and Canada. They have simple, broad leaves and capsule fruit. Flowers are visited by Syrphid fly, Toxomerus geminatus, and Small-handed Leaf-cutter Bee. Individuals can grow to 0.8 m.
